"The Laws of Lifetime Growth" by Dan Sullivan is a powerful guide designed to inspire readers to constantly expand their horizons and never settle for past achievements. Sullivan introduces ten key principles—the "laws"—that empower individuals to continually create a bigger, more fulfilling future. The book contends that growth should be perpetual and that the only limits to a brighter future are those we impose on ourselves. By adopting a mindset that favors contribution, learning, and curiosity, readers are encouraged to see every experience as an opportunity for evolution. Sullivan's insights help cultivate a resilient attitude, increase personal innovation, and promote a vision where tomorrow is always more promising than yesterday.
Sullivan emphasizes that personal and professional growth happens when individuals refuse to see their past as the best they'll ever achieve. Instead, he encourages cultivating a mindset oriented toward expansion. By focusing on what you can become rather than what you have been, you open yourself to new possibilities. This forward-looking approach helps eliminate complacency and drives persistent improvement, empowering readers to envision personal and professional milestones yet to be reached.
One core principle is the transformation of setbacks into opportunities. Sullivan explains that failures aren't endpoints but springboards for greater achievement. By reframing disappointments as valuable learning experiences, individuals develop resilience and adaptability. This principle cultivates confidence in navigating uncertain or challenging circumstances, ensuring that obstacles serve as catalysts for ingenuity and progress rather than barriers limiting future potential.
Rather than measuring success by comparison with others, Sullivan encourages readers to value their unique contributions. The book asserts that growth thrives in environments where individuals focus on what they can give, not just what they can get. Contribution fuels purpose and creates meaning, providing enduring motivation. By seeking to add value to the lives of others, individuals build stronger relationships, teams, and organizations capable of sustained advancement.
Sullivan highlights the necessity of relentless curiosity and lifelong learning in the pursuit of continuous growth. He urges readers to treat every situation as an opportunity to acquire insight. Adopting a student mindset leads to adaptability, creativity, and the consistent application of new knowledge. This openness to learning ensures every experience—positive or negative—becomes fodder for expansion, reinforcing the journey of lifetime growth.
